Overview

I Buried the Light by Palvushina Svetlana is a chilling, first-person psychological memoir based on a killer's descent into darkness. Blending the raw emotion of a true crime autobiography with the disturbing intimacy of criminal psychology, this book exposes the fractured mind of a man shaped by trauma, addiction, and the need to possess what he could never keep-innocence. Set in the shadowed corners of the 1970s Bahamas, a tropical paradise hiding generational violence, this psychological true crime novel pulls readers into the childhood of a boy who escaped his abusive home by drawing disturbing art-images of crying children, twisted limbs, and silent screams. What began as survival became obsession. Told entirely in first-person confession, I Buried the Light explores themes of abuse, fractured identity, addiction, and murder. It's a killer's memoir, layered with the tragic beauty of a life spiraling into darkness. Through failed attempts at redemption-a stint in seminary, a broken marriage, a love doomed by violence-the narrator's descent becomes chillingly inevitable. This serial killer book based on a true story catalogues the calculated murders of young boys in Grand Bahama between 2003 and 2004. Each victim is documented, boxed, and logged like a piece of art. But even monsters unravel. When international investigators close in, the killer walks into a police station, offering a complete confession-and an invitation into his fractured world.
